			<description><![CDATA[<p>@rolfie, use a live cd , download older versions (=3.2.7-3) of eudev &amp; libeudev1 from <a href="https://pkgmaster.devuan.org/devuan/pool/main/e/eudev/" rel="nofollow">https://pkgmaster.devuan.org/devuan/pool/main/e/eudev/</a> to devuan partition/usb stick,<br />reboot to devuan recovery mode, and install (dpkg -i $package) the downloaded debs. <br />that&#039;s just one way to do it. (couldn&#039;t get network from recovery mode as #111 mentioned, so had to use live cd)</p><p>also my 2c : <br />mate w/ slim+consolekit is buggy in beowulf. works fine in ascii. <br />mate w/ lightdm+elogind is a better more stable choice with newer versions of policykit, elogind, etc.</p>]]></description>

			<description><![CDATA[<p>From the <span class="bbu"><a href="https://files.devuan.org/devuan_ascii/Release_notes.txt" rel="nofollow">ASCII release notes</a></span>:</p><div class="quotebox"><blockquote><div><p>### Session management and policykit backends</p><p>Devuan 2.0 ASCII provides a choice of 5 Desktop Environments at<br />install time (XFCE, Cinnamon, KDE, LXQT, MATE), while many other<br />window managers are available from the repositories.</p><p>These days, Desktop Environments rely on a session management system<br />to allow the user to perform several typical tasks without requiring<br />administrator privileges, including suspending/rebooting/shutting down<br />the system, mounting external devices, configuring networking, and so<br />on.</p><p>Two of such session management systems are available in Devuan 2.0<br />ASCII, namely:</p><p>&#160; - consolekit<br />&#160; - elogind</p><p>These session managers are mutually exclusive, only one of them can be<br />installed and active at a time to avoid unwanted interference.&#160; In<br />order to grant processes in the unprivileged user session access to<br />select privileged operations, the installed session manager is<br />connected to the policykit-1 framework by a set of matching back-end<br />libraries.</p><p>Each of the 5 DEs available in Devuan comes with a recommended default<br />combination of login manager (either slim or lightdm) and session<br />management system:</p><p>&#160; - XFCE: slim + consolekit<br />&#160; - Cinnamon: lightdm + elogind<br />&#160; - KDE: lightdm + elogind<br />&#160; - LXQT: lightdm + elogind<br />&#160; - MATE: slim + consolekit<br />&#160; <br />In order for session management to work correctly, the login manager<br />(aka display manager, DM) has to register the user session with the<br />installed session manager (i.e. either consolekit or elogind), which<br />in turn has to cooperate with the relevant components of the desktop<br />environment. The default pairings listed above are known to work well<br />and do not require user intervention, but other combinations are<br />possible.</p></div></blockquote></div>]]></description>
